The build-in matlab function ode45 . matlab can be used to solve numerically second and higher order ordinary differential equations subject to some initial conditions by transfering the problem into equivalent 2 x 2 system of ordinary differential equations of first order. A function for numerical solution of such systems is, for example, \( \texttt{ode45} \) . WebA symbolic method is only needed if, for example, you want a formula or if you need to ensure precision.
